Common use of Authorization for Overtime Pay Clause in Contracts

Authorization for Overtime Pay. a) Overtime will be worked only when the Department Head or designate has requested that overtime be worked. Compensation for overtime shall be paid at two (2) times the employee's regular hourly rate for hours worked to the next one-half hour. Overtime shall normally be paid, but if there is mutual agreement between an employee and the Department Head or designate, equivalent time off may be taken to a maximum of thirty-five (35) hours in any one calendar year. Overtime taken as time off in lieu shall be equivalent to the number of hours for which she/he would have been paid, to a maximum of thirty-five (35) hours in any one calendar year. The time off in lieu shall be taken within twelve (12) months of the date the overtime was worked at a time mutually agreeable to the employee and the Department Head or designate. Time off in lieu which is not taken within that twelve (12) month period shall be paid out to the employee at the end of that period.
